Lawmakers Introduce Bill to Bolster Magnitsky Sanctions Against Human Rights Abusers
Leaders of the U.S. Helsinki Commission have introduced a bill seeking to strengthen Global Magnitsky sanctions to improve the United States’ ability to hold human rights abusers and corrupt actors accountable. The incoming chair of the commission Sen. Ben Cardin (D-Md.) and co-chair Sen. Roger Wicker (R-Miss.) on Wednesday unveiled the Global Magnitsky Human Rights Accountability…
Former University of Florida Researcher Indicted for Concealing Ties to CCP
Federal prosecutors on Feb. 4 indicted a former University of Florida professor who concealed the support he received from the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) when obtaining $1.75 million in U.S. taxpayer grant money for research that benefited a firm he secretly founded in China. I Was Persecuted by the Chinese Regime After Meeting the Son of Pro-Democracy Figure Zhao Ziyang
Commentary Jan. 17 marks the 16th anniversary of the death of former Chinese Communist Party (CCP) leader Zhao Ziyang. When the democratic protest movement occurred in 1989, he stood on the side of the people. Consequently, Zhao was purged from the Party, but he became a symbol of democracy.
